How do you measure how hot a pepper is? Scoville ratings for peppers also changes according to a type of pepper's growing conditions like humidity and soil and also the pepper's maturity, seed lineage, and other factors. There are aspects that affect the findings enough that different laboratories would sometimes have wildly varying results, sometimes up to a 50% difference on tests. These peppers file into five categories — Capsicum annuum, Capsicum chinense, Capsicum frutescens, Capsicum baccatum and Capsicum pubescens.
